Lead/Staff Software Engineer (Full Stack)

State Affairs
CA, United States
Full-time

Lead / Staff Software Engineer - Full Stack

Location : Bay Area, California (San Jose - Santana Row)

We are an In-person company. Not hiring for remote roles. (Relocation can be considered for stellar candidates)

We are unable to sponsor work permits / visas at this time.

About the Company :

State Affairs is a media company delivering nonpartisan, statehouse news and intelligence across the country. We are seeking a talented and experienced Staff Full Stack Engineer to lead the design, development, and implementation of our web-based applications.

This person will work directly with the Head of Engineering and Product to build scalable, extensible solutions with emphasis on innovation and quality.

About the Role :

As a Staff Full Stack Engineer at State Affairs, you will lead a team of engineers in architecting, building, and maintaining scalable and efficient web applications using Node.

js, Next.js, React, AWS, MySQL, and RDS. You will collaborate with cross-functional teams to deliver high-quality solutions that meet business objectives and exceed user expectations.

Responsibilities :

  • Lead the design and development of complex web applications, ensuring adherence to best practices and architectural standards.
  • Provide technical leadership and mentorship to junior and mid-level engineers, fostering a culture of continuous learning and growth.
  • Architect and implement front-end components and user interfaces.
  • Develop large-scale distributed systems and client-server architectures.
  • Develop and integrate server-side logic and APIs.
  • Design and implement scalable data storage solutions.
  • Lead efforts to optimize application performance, scalability, and reliability.
  • Drive the adoption of best practices, coding standards, and development methodologies within the team.
  • Stay abreast of emerging technologies and industry trends, evaluating their potential impact on our technical stack and business strategy.

Qualifications :

  • Bachelor's degree or Master’s in Computer Science, Engineering, or related field (or equivalent experience).
  • At least 10+ years of professional software development experience, with a focus on web applications.
  • Proven experience as a technical leader or Staff Engineer in a fast-paced environment.
  • Strong proficiency in JavaScript, HTML, and CSS.
  • Extensive experience with Node.js, React.js, and Next.js.
  • Solid understanding of AWS services, including EC2, S3, Lambda, API Gateway, and CloudFormation.
  • Familiarity with AI / ML concepts and a strong interest in developing AI-driven features and models.
  • Experience with relational databases, preferably MySQL and RDS.
  • Excellent problem-solving and analytical skills.
  • Strong communication, collaboration, and leadership skills.
  • Ability to drive technical initiatives and influence decision-making at all levels of the organization.
  • Experience with serverless architecture and AWS Lambda.
  • Knowledge of containerization technologies such as Docker and Kubernetes.
  • Familiarity with CI / CD pipelines and automation tools.
  • Understanding of security best practices and compliance standards.

What We Offer :

  • Competitive salary and benefits package, including health insurance, and paid time off.
  • Opportunity to work on cutting-edge projects in a growing industry.
  • A collaborative and supportive work environment that values personal growth and professional development.
  • The chance to make a meaningful impact on the legislative process and help clients stay informed and engaged in state affairs.

About State Affairs :

At State Affairs, we believe access to trustworthy information is critical for a functioning democracy. Our mission is to provide nonpartisan news and intelligence about the power centers of state government.

Our unbiased coverage and cutting-edge tools are essential for policymakers, government officials, business leaders, and engaged private citizens, enabling them to perform their jobs, make better decisions, and hold their government accountable.

1 day ago
Related jobs
Promoted
VirtualVocations
Burbank, California

A company is looking for a Full Stack Engineer (VA CDS) to join their team. ...

Promoted
PayPal
San Jose, California

As a Team Lead software engineer for Venmo Payments and Disputes Engineering you will act as a senior engineer and subject matter expert for the Payments Platform Engineering team. Ability to lead projects and mentor all levels of engineering staff, along with managing relationships with Product, En...

Promoted
Apple
Cupertino, California

Participate in product design reviews to ensure performance optimization and monitoring is a core component of design Collaborate with stakeholders and cross-functional leaders in engineering, product, and operations across Apple to ensure the adoption of our data platform is done in a security comp...

General Motors
Mountain View, California

Staff Full Stack Software Engineer. This role provides a unique opportunity where you will be working across all of the GM Commercial Services software products, and truly steering the future of GM Commercial Services' full stack architecture, APIs, products, and customers. Proven ability to develop...

AmorServ
San Francisco, California

Role:Senior Software Engineer (Full-Stack). Lead and mentor a team of engineers, data scientists, and developers as the startup grows. Experience working in a startup environment or within a company with fewer than 20 engineers. Architect and develop software solutions that leverage AI technology (L...

The Resource Collaborative, Inc.
Cupertino, California

You need to be experienced as a Full-Stack Engineer as you will be working with BE, DE and SWEs. Independently and collaboratively lead client engagement workstreams focused on improvement, optimization, and transformation of processes including implementing leading practice workflows, addressing de...

Jerry
San Francisco, California

We are looking for a Senior Full Stack Engineer who is passionate about solving complex, meaningful problems to join our Auto Refinance team. Working closely with our brilliant product managers, software engineers, data scientists, designers, and operations team members, you will play a key role in ...

Games Jobs Direct
San Mateo, California

As a Senior Software Engineer (Full Stack) on the Roblox Operating Systems team, you will be responsible for driving engineering efforts for building and scaling a suite of applications and reusable components to empower other Builders in various roles such as People Operations, Talent Acquisition, ...

Disney Entertainment & ESPN Technology
Santa Monica, California

Lead projects where you’ll work closely with engineering and product teams to scope and distill product requirements into design and technical specifications. The Disney Entertainment & ESPN Technology (DEE&T) Commerce, Growth and Identity Client Engineering organization delivers experiences across ...

hu.ma.ne
San Francisco, California

Lead Software Engineer, Device Experiences. Humane is a team of proven industry experts who have invented, built, and shipped category-defining hardware and software products to billions of people across the globe. Our vision for the next shift between humans and computing requires innovation across...